Fossils, the preserved stays or traces of historic organisms, are predominantly found inside sedimentary rock formations. This affiliation arises from the precise situations required for fossilization and the processes concerned within the creation of various rock varieties. Sedimentary rocks type via the buildup and cementation of sediments akin to sand, silt, clay, and natural matter. For example, a prehistoric animal carcass is perhaps buried by layers of sediment in a riverbed, finally resulting in fossil formation as minerals substitute the natural materials.

The importance of this geological context lies within the preservation potential supplied by sedimentary environments. The gradual accumulation of sediment offers a protecting barrier towards scavengers, weathering, and different damaging forces that will in any other case decompose the stays. Moreover, the comparatively low temperatures and pressures related to sedimentary rock formation are conducive to preserving the fragile buildings of organisms. The historic context is important, as sedimentary rocks signify a chronological file of Earth’s historical past, capturing snapshots of life types that existed at completely different geological durations. This contributes considerably to our understanding of evolution, paleontology, and previous environments.
